Understanding the Basics of a Subwoofer Box
First, I had to understand that a subwoofer box isn’t just a container—it dramatically affects sound quality. The enclosure helps control the movement of the subwoofer cones and enhances bass output. For two 12-inch subwoofers, the box needs to be designed to accommodate both drivers properly.
Types of Subwoofer Boxes for 2 12-inch Subs
I found there are mainly three types of enclosures to consider:
- Sealed Boxes: These are airtight and provide tight, accurate bass. I liked these when I wanted cleaner sound without booming.
- Ported Boxes: These have a vent or port, making the bass louder and deeper. I chose ported boxes when I wanted more volume and thump.
- Bandpass Boxes: These are more complex and give very loud bass at a narrow frequency range. I tried these only when I wanted to push my subs to the limit.
Material and Build Quality
My experience taught me that the box’s material matters. MDF (Medium-Density Fiberboard) is the most common and preferred because it’s dense and prevents unwanted vibrations. I avoided cheap particle board as it didn’t hold up well to bass vibrations. Also, good sealing and quality bracing inside the box made a noticeable difference in sound clarity.
Size and Dimensions Matter
Each subwoofer model has a recommended enclosure volume. For my two 12-inch subs, I checked the manufacturer’s specs to know the ideal internal cubic feet for the box. A box that’s too small or too large can negatively affect performance. I measured my trunk space beforehand to ensure the box would fit comfortably without compromising car space.
Ported or Sealed for My Preferences
Choosing between ported and sealed was tough. I preferred sealed boxes for tight, punchy bass suitable for most music genres. But if you want that booming sound typical of hip-hop or EDM, ported boxes might be your best bet. I also noted that ported boxes are generally larger, so space availability is a key factor.
DIY vs Pre-Made Boxes
I considered building my own box but eventually bought a pre-made one to save time. If you have woodworking skills, a DIY box lets you customize dimensions and finish. Otherwise, many manufacturers offer well-designed boxes specifically for 2 12-inch subwoofers that fit most vehicles.
